diff options
author | Pierre Neidhardt <mail@ambrevar.xyz> | 2020-02-24 13:50:43 +0100 |
---|---|---|
committer | Pierre Neidhardt <mail@ambrevar.xyz> | 2020-02-24 13:50:43 +0100 |
commit | 453ec521daeb739b4c794516ba5f03260e91fe00 (patch) | |
tree | bd5f249875e0c0864118b883676ef8191eec703a /nonguix/build-system/binary.scm | |
parent | ff6ca98099c7c90e64256236a49ab21fa96fe11e (diff) |
nonguix: Use the install-plan of the copy-build-system in the binary-build-system.
* nonguix/build-system/binary.scm (lower): Adapt the default value of the
install plan.
* nonguix/build/binary-build-system.scm (new-install): New procedure.
(old-install): Rename former `install' procedure to this.
(install): New procedure that dispatches over old-install and new-install.
Diffstat (limited to 'nonguix/build-system/binary.scm')
-rw-r--r-- | nonguix/build-system/binary.scm |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/nonguix/build-system/binary.scm b/nonguix/build-system/binary.scm index 2c2bae6..2655e15 100644 --- a/nonguix/build-system/binary.scm +++ b/nonguix/build-system/binary.scm @@ -23,6 +23,7 @@ #:use-module (guix search-paths) #:use-module (guix build-system) #:use-module (guix build-system gnu) + ;; #:use-module (guix build-system copy) #:use-module (guix packages) #:use-module (ice-9 match) #:use-module (srfi srfi-1) @@ -37,7 +38,7 @@ ;; Commentary: ;; ;; Standard build procedure for binary packages. This is implemented as an -;; extension of `gnu-build-system'. +;; extension of `copy-build-system'. ;; ;; Code: @@ -78,7 +79,6 @@ `(("source" ,source)) '()) ,@inputs - ;; Keep the standard inputs of 'gnu-build-system'. ,@(standard-packages))) (build-inputs `(("patchelf" ,patchelf) @@ -94,7 +94,7 @@ #:key (guile #f) (outputs '("out")) (patchelf-plan ''()) - (install-plan ''(("." (".") "./"))) + (install-plan ''(("." "./"))) (search-paths '()) (out-of-source? #t) (validate-runpath? #t) |